def interpolate_color(color_a, color_b, t):
"""
Interpolate between two RGB color strings based on a float t between 0 and 1.

Args:
color_a (str): RGB color string in the format "#RRGGBB".
color_b (str): RGB color string in the format "#RRGGBB".
t (float): A float between 0 and 1 representing the interpolation factor.

Returns:
str: Interpolated color as an RGB string in the format "#RRGGBB".
"""
if not (0 <= t <= 1):
raise ValueError("Interpolation factor t must be between 0 and 1")

# Convert hex color strings to RGB tuples
def hex_to_rgb(hex_color):
hex_color = hex_color.lstrip("#")
return tuple(int(hex_color[i : i + 2], 16) for i in (0, 2, 4))

# Convert RGB tuples back to hex color strings
def rgb_to_hex(rgb):
return f"#{''.join(f'{c:02x}' for c in rgb)}"

rgb_a = hex_to_rgb(color_a)
rgb_b = hex_to_rgb(color_b)

# Interpolate each color channel
interpolated_rgb = tuple(int(a + (b - a) * t) for a, b in zip(rgb_a, rgb_b))

return rgb_to_hex(interpolated_rgb)
